Burkina Faso's SONABEL Launches National Campaign to Inventory Assets and Customers
The Société nationale d'électricité du Burkina (SONABEL) officially launched a nationwide campaign on Monday, June 22, 2026, in Ouagadougou. This large-scale operation aims to conduct a census of the company's electricity infrastructure and its customer base. The initiative is part of SONABEL's broader strategy to modernize and digitalize its electricity distribution network. A key objective is to establish a reliable and up-to-date database of both its physical assets and its subscribers. This data will be crucial for enhancing the quality of service provided to customers. The campaign is expected to provide SONABEL with a clearer picture of its operational landscape and customer engagement.
